You are viewing the CopperCoins catalog page for 2020D•1DR•001, a documented Lincoln cent die variety. This listing is cataloged as a Doubled Die Reverse, from 2020, and struck at the Denver Mint. It is recorded as class 9 - Shifted Hub Doubling. Below you will find 1 stage of identification photos and markers, catalog cross references, and reported values for coins minted with this die.

Die Notes

Separation with extra parts of a crown base to the south of the primary crown base show at the tops of stripes 3, 5, 7 and 9.
